ΕΠΙΚΡΟΤΗΣΙ, επικροτησι
EPIKROTĒSI, epikrotēsi
Sounds Like: ep-ee-kro-TEE-see
Translations: applause, a clapping, acclamation
From the root: ΕΠΙΚΡΟΤΗΣΙΣ
Part of Speech: Noun
Explanation: This word refers to the act of clapping or applauding, often as a sign of approval or acclamation. It describes the sound or action of hands being clapped together, typically in a public setting to show appreciation or agreement.
Inflection: Singular, Dative, Feminine
